Re: New Camping “Essential”: Bluetti AC180 Power Station

Crewzer ·
One more hopefully useful post. Like many power stations, the Bluetti AC180 can be recharged from a 12 V vehicle power socket via its DC/PV input port. However, most limit charge current to ~10 A to avoid overloading the socket and its fuse. The AC180’s input current limit is 8 A for DC voltages below ~30 V. Its battery energy spec is 1152 Wh, equivalent to a 12.8 V x 90 Ah battery. Assuming 90% charging efficiency, it could take up to ~13 hours to recharge the PS’s battery from a vehicle...

New Victron 50 Amp DC/DC Converter / Charger

Crewzer ·
It seems Victron recently introduced a new 12 V (nominal) DC/DC converter / charger rated at 50 Amps: https://www.victronenergy.com/...c-dc-battery-charger 50 Amps isn’t that big of a deal. However, there are several other features that caught my attention: * Input current can be set and limited in 0.1 A increments * Output current can be set and limited in 0.1 A increments * Input- and output voltages, currents, and power can be monitored via Victron app * Low ambient temperature disconnect...
